What is the radius of a circle diameter?
The radius of a circle is a line segment that starts from the center of a circle and ends at the circumference of the circle. It is half the length of the diameter of a circle, i.e., Radius = Diameter/2.

How do you find a circumference?
To find the circumference of a circle, multiply the circle’s diameter by pi (3.14).
What is the formula of diameter and radius?
The formula for the radius can be written as r=d2, and the formula for diameter can be written as d=2r.

Is radius half of diameter?
The radius of a circle is the length of the line segment from the center of a circle to a point on the circumference of the circle and diameter is a line segment from one end of the circle to the other end of the circle passing through the center of the circle. So, the radius is half the length of the diameter.

What are the three dimensions of a circle?
There are three dimensions most often used to describe a circle: 1 The diameter – defined above 2 The radius – the distance from the circle’s center or origin to the edge, one half the diameter 3 The circumference – the length of the outside boundaries of the circle More
